Duncan Lovejoy
|
Duncan Lovejoy has not joined the site yet. Do you know where Duncan Lovejoy is? If so, please click here to invite Duncan to join our site!
|
Duncan Lovejoy has not joined the site yet. Do you know where Duncan Lovejoy is? If so, please click here to invite Duncan to join our site!